    ASSERTION: If an electron and proton possessing same kinetic energy enter an electric field in a perpendicular direction, the path of the electron is more curved than that of the proton.
    REASON: Electron forms a large curve due to its small mass.

    A) If both assertion and reason are true and reason is the correct explanation of assertion.

    B) If both assertion and reason are true and reason is not the correct explanation of assertion.

    C) If assertion is true but reason is false.

    D) If both assertion and reason are false.

    E) If assertion is false but reason is true.

    Correct Answer: D

    Solution :

    As \[qE=\frac{m{{v}^{2}}}{r},r=\frac{m{{v}^{2}}}{qE}=\frac{2K\,.\,E\,.}{q\,E}\] \[\left( K.\,E.\,=\frac{1}{2}\,m{{v}^{2}} \right)\] i.e., \[r\propto \frac{1}{q}\] Since electron and proton have equal charge, r is the same for both of them. Here, r depends on K.E. (which is given to be the same for both the particles) and as such not on their masses.
